Government-owned insurer Life Insurance Corporation of India (LIC) has earned a Guinness World Records title for selling the most life insurance policies in 24 hours. This historic achievement, ...
Editorial Note: Forbes Advisor may earn a commission on sales made from partner links on this page, but that doesn't affect our editors' opinions or evaluations. There are 25 leading life insurance ...
If there is one institution that commands unshakable faith across India, it is the Life Insurance Corporation or LIC. More than an insurer, it is a symbol of trust woven into India's social and ...